Sheet Structure

The template comprises five interconnected sheets:

  • Dashboard – Central hub displaying KPIs, charts, and summary metrics.
  • Research Projects – Master database of all ongoing and planned research initiatives.
  • Budget & Funding – Tracks financial allocations, expenditures, and funding sources.
  • Milestones & Timeline – Records project deliverables, deadlines, and progress percentages.
  • Team & Resources – Manages personnel assignments, roles, and resource utilization.

Formulas and Automation

  • Dashboard KPIs: Use of SUMIFS(), COUNTIFS(), and AVERAGEIF() to dynamically calculate total projects, funding gap ($), average budget per project, and success rate (% completed).
  • Funding Gap: Formula: =SUM([Funded Amount]) - SUM([Total Budget]) → Negative value indicates underfunding.
  • Project Timeline Duration: =DATEDIF([Start Date],[End Date],"m") to compute months.
  • Status Color Mapping: Uses VLOOKUP() or XLOOKUP() with a status-color lookup table to assign color codes for conditional formatting.

Conditional Formatting Rules

  • Status Column: Green for “Completed”, Blue for “In Progress”, Yellow for “Planned”, Red for “Paused”.
  • Budget Utilization: Cells with funding % under 70% highlighted in orange; over 110% in red.
  • Milestone Delay: If current date > Due Date and Status ≠ “Completed”, row turns light red.
  • Funding Source Diversity: A heatmap on the Dashboard shows which agencies fund the most projects (using data bars).

Recommended Charts & Dashboard Elements

  • Pie Chart: Funding Sources Breakdown (% of total funds allocated).
  • Stacked Bar Chart: Research Area Budget Allocation vs. Actual Expenditure.
  • Gantt-style Timeline: Created using horizontal bar charts showing project durations and overlap.
  • KPI Cards (Text Boxes with Icons): “Total Projects: 24”, “Funding Gap: -$187,000”, “Avg. Project Duration: 26 months” — linked dynamically to the tables.
  • Top 5 High-Impact Projects: Ranked by projected impact score (user-defined scale of 1–10) and funded amount.

User Instructions

  1. Enter new research projects in the “Research Projects” sheet using the dropdowns for Status and Research Area.
  2. Update funding amounts and dates weekly to ensure dashboard accuracy.
  3. Link each project to its milestones in “Milestones & Timeline” by matching Project ID.
  4. Avoid manually editing cells on the Dashboard sheet—they are formula-driven. Only edit source data sheets.
  5. Use Data Validation lists to maintain consistency across entries.
  6. Refresh pivot tables and charts by pressing F9 or clicking “Refresh All” under the Data tab.
